2025 03 26 1160x1696 e8c581ecda4a5c581240a1dc9ada2031482ad22e7a765804

2025 03 26 1160x1696 e8c581ecda4a5c581240a1dc9ada2031482ad22e7a765804

36 views

1160 × 1696 — JPEG 287.3 KB

Uploaded 7 months ago

No description provided.